Filter Configuration Command Reference
522 Router Configuration Guide
system-filter
Syntax system-filter
Context config>filter
Description This command enables the context to activate system filter policies.
mac-filter
Syntax mac-filter filter-id [create]
[no] mac-filter {filter-id | filter-name}
Context config>filter
Description This command, creates a configuration context for the specified MAC filter policy if it does not exist,
and enables the context to configure the specified MAC filter policy.
The no form of the command deletes the MAC filter policy. A filter policy cannot be deleted until it
is removed from all objects where it is applied.
Default No MAC filter policy is created by default.
Parameters filter-id — Specifies the MAC filter policy ID expressed as a decimal integer.
Values 1 to 65535
create — Keyword required to create the configuration context. Once it is created, the context can
be enabled with or without the create keyword.
filter-name — A string of up to 64 characters uniquely identifying this MAC filter policy.
redirect-policy
Syntax no redirect-policy redirect-policy-name [create]
no redirect-policy redirect-policy-name
Context config>filter
Description This command, creates a configuration context for the specified redirect policy if it does not exist, and
enables the context to configure the redirect policy.
The no form of the command removes the redirect policy from the filter configuration only if the policy
is not referenced in a filter and the filter is not in use (applied to a service or network interface).
Default No redirect policy is created by default.
